Vince Zampella, who helped create the immensely successful video game Call of Duty, has tragically died in a car accident in Los Angeles, California at the age of 55.

His passing was announced by Electronic Arts, the publisher that controls Respawn Entertainment, the development studio which he helped establish.

The renowned video game developer lost his life when his vehicle was involved in a crash and burst into flames on a freeway in the Los Angeles area on this past Sunday, US media outlets report.

"This is a devastating loss, and we stand with Vince's loved ones, those closest to him, and all those touched by his creative vision," a spokesperson for Electronic Arts commented.
